A simple and smart bulk file renamer. Just rename 1 file and it will do the rest.

Install Scoop if you don't already have it - In a Powershell:
Set-ExecutionPolicy -ExecutionPolicy RemoteSigned -Scope CurrentUser
Invoke-RestMethod -Uri https://get.scoop.sh | Invoke-Expression
You can then install SimpleRenamer with:
scoop install -s https://raw.githubusercontent.com/Inspirateur/SimpleRenamer/refs/heads/master/SimpleRenamer.json
This will create a "Batch Rename" entry in the context menu, if you don't want it find and open "Regedit" and delete the HKCU:\Software\Classes\*\Shell\Batch Rename
key.
You can uninstall it with scoop uninstall SimpleRenamer
I don't have any prebuilt binaries for other platform, so you will have to:
- install rust with https://rustup.rs/
- clone the repository to have the source code on your machine
- in the repository folder run
cargo build --release
This should compile SimpleRenamer and produce a "gui.exe" binary you can use on your machine. You can add it to the Path or create an alias if you want to invoke it from the command line.
